Output e8b4a907077fa43a4c79f6d212017591e42006cb104e0003982ffe92a2f07bfd:4

value
28409
script pubkey
OP_0 OP_PUSHBYTES_20 13f24d25ce582ba2efddf9adb78ef6fcef977168
address
bc1qz0ey6fwwtq469m7alxkm0rhklnhewutgqaxj5g
transaction
e8b4a907077fa43a4c79f6d212017591e42006cb104e0003982ffe92a2f07bfd